A Holistic Approach to Dog Care — What It Means and How to Build One

The word "holistic" gets used a lot in pet care — sometimes meaningfully, sometimes as little more than a marketing label. For dog owners who are genuinely interested in a whole-body approach to their dog's everyday wellbeing, it's worth unpacking what it actually means in practice. Holistic dog care isn't a single product or a specific diet. It's a philosophy of care that considers the whole dog — coat and skin, digestion, movement, daily routine and emotional wellbeing — rather than addressing individual concerns in isolation.
